OHC Language School in Sydney is one of the branches of Oxford House International School, where English courses are offered for a variety of different age groups and purposes. Here you can prepare for an international exam and vocabulary, learn to teach English, following a flexible schedule of group or individual lessons. OHC Sydney Campus is located in the Holmes Institute building in the city center on York Street, next to cozy cafes and restaurants, with a convenient traffic interchange, a few steps from two railway stations. Programs and prices, tuition fees in OHC Language School Sydney
General English
English for everyday life: speaking, listening, reading, writing, vocabulary and grammar. Knowledge gained in the course will allow working in an English-speaking environment. Experienced teachers will turn learning English into an interesting adventure and help expand vocabulary and improve pronunciation. Lessons have a big advantage - a flexible schedule that will be convenient for everyone.
General English plus
The General English Plus program provides a choice of one additional skill or class plus a general English course. 25 hours of study per week help you achieve your goals faster, and the choice of topics and areas of study also serves: you can focus on spoken English, on grammatical knowledge in writing.

English for academic purposes
- Cost: $ 360 per week.
English for academic purposes is a course for students who are to study in English. There is language learning at the university level, instilling confidence and fluency. Lessons can take place as a full day, or in addition to another course.
English language programs for foreign English teachers
Oddly enough, most English lessons are taught by teachers whose first language is not English. For such teachers, it is proposed to deepen the knowledge of the subject and develop pedagogical skills in one of the courses: “Creative Methodology” or “Professional Development”. Each of the programs covers the latest methodological theories of teaching.
Accommodation, meals, prices
The student service carefully selects homestay options for each student with different boarding options. The hosts try to provide students with the opportunity to explore the local culture. Most often, houses for living are located from the school a maximum of 50 minutes by public transport.
Guests are provided with food at a very affordable price, the owners are ready to take into account special wishes regarding the kitchen, which they are asked to warn in advance. The default settlement takes place on the eve of the first day of class on Sunday and ends on Saturday after the last day of class.

Admission dates and extra charges
You can apply for a course at any time, however, given that all courses and accommodation options are subject to availability, it is recommended that you apply as early as possible. Courses start every Monday.
Extras:
- Special diet food 75 AUD
- Extra night 60 AUD
- Registration fee (for a programme/course) 250 AUD
- Transfer (one way) 155 AUD
- Medical insurance 55 AUD
- Study materials 80 AUD
